Job TitleProposal ManagerJob Description SummaryJob Description SummaryThis is a 14-month contract position responsible for leading the proposal management efforts for our Global Occupier Services (GOS) Enterprise Sales team, ensuring the clarity, compliance, and integrity of all pursuit-related documents. This Proposal Manager collaborates with sales, commercial, and platform teams, acting as the key liaison to coordinate all internal work streams for finalizing proposal responses. This individual will write, track, and review all proposal content with cross-functional business teams and oversee the final submission. Additionally, a Proposal Manager is responsible for developing all presentation materials, effectively communicating our client solution and value. The preferred candidate is proactive, solution-oriented, and comfortable working in a deadline-driven environment. While the ideal candidate is located in Chicago, Dallas, or St. Louis, remote candidates are also welcome.Job DescriptionCore Responsibilities

This high-visibility role calls for a confident and creative professional with excellent strategic-thinking, writing, project management, analytical, and collaboration skills.

Manage the entire proposal and presentation development process, leading regional multi-service and single service line pursuits; this includes RFPs, presentations, and various client deliverables.

Ensure every member of the pursuit team, including sales leads, solution managers, operational subject matter experts, pricing, and graphic designers know what is expected and when tasks are due.

Work closely with sales leads and operational subject matter experts to develop proposal responses and best-in-class presentations.

Work with sales team and leadership to ensure required approvals at various stages are met.

Identify all graphic design needs and engage appropriate design resources.

Develop a tailored proposal clearly describing the value of the solution; liaise with subject matter experts as required to contribute to and review the response.

Write Executive Summaries and cover letters tailored to client solutions

Oversee production and on-time electronic and/or hardcopy delivery to clients.

Support Senior Proposal Managers with multi-service or global pursuits.

Pull baseline responses from content library to develop first drafts for proposals; review and edit final drafts.

Lead regional and global RFIs including project management, response development, and collaboration with sales team and subject matter experts.

Write, edit, format, and proof all proposal and presentation deliverables; responsible for conducting red team reviews with team members to ensure high-quality work product.

Manage the preparation of other deliverables related to the new business opportunity such as presentations and follow-up requests.

Attend prep sessions as needed/requested by sales leads and pursuit teams.

Support new content development efforts and strategic firm initiatives as needed.

Upload all final deliverables to proposal and presentation libraries.

Perform pursuit close-out activities; work with Knowledge Management to ensure revised and new content is uploaded to content library.

Perform other related duties as required or requested.

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in marketing, communications, business, or related field preferred

2+ years of experience working in a proposal management environment.

Knowledge & Experience

Demonstrates experience in proposal management environment.

Project management skills with experience in developing, communicating, and managing against project plans with defined timelines.

Skills & Personal Qualities

Ability to multitask while creating high-end results.

Excellent verbal and written communications skills with ability to articulate complex concepts simply and effectively.

Detail-oriented; strong organizational skills and effective time management.

Commercial real estate industry knowledge and experience is preferred; the right candidate is proactive, self-motivated, and eager to learn.

Ability to maintain strict confidentiality of sensitive information.

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, Teams, OneDrive) and Adobe Acrobat.
